Selfies take over Week of Welcome celebrations at USF College of Nursing
Traditionally, College of Nursing students take part in workshops and meet and greet activities during the USF Week of Welcome (WOW). However, this year, the college took the WOW celebrations to a slightly “untraditional” direction…by hosting a “selfies with the dean,” that is.
Of course, selfies were a great hit. Dozens of students lined up in the college’s gathering space for an opportunity to meet and take selfies with Dianne Morrison-Beedy, PhD, RN, WHNP-BC, FAANP, FNAP, FAAN, senior associate vice president of USF Health and dean of the USF College of Nursing.
College of Nursing celebrated new and current students during USF Week of Welcome. Students were welcomed by faculty and staff and were also treated with food, beverages and other fun activities.
